Catalytic Activity of Superoxide Dismutase Entrapped in Microemulsion

Abstract:W/O type microemulsion was used to simulate the microenvironment of living cell. The catalytic activity of superoxide dismutase entrapped in microemulsion formed by CTAB was studied. The influence of some factors on the catalytic activity was also discussed.
